Anthrax found in northern Alberta cattle

Beef producers in Alberta are being warned to look out for anthrax, after cases have been confirmed in two separate cattle farms in the Fort Vermilion area. The hot and dry weather the area has been getting can make it easier for livestock to be exposed.

Alberta Agriculture and Forestry says there’s normally a few cases reported in western Canada reported around this time of year, and there have been confirmed cases in Saskatchewan recently. If you suspect an animal maybe be infected, or if one suddenly dies, contact a veterinarian immediately.
